Crime overview

London Road area has the 11th highest crime rate of 27 local areas in Stanford-le-Hope West , and the 249th lowest crime rate of 501 local areas in Thurrock .

This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around London Road (SS17 0LB) in the last 12 months was 61.1 per 1,000 residents and was 36.1% lower than the Stanford-le-Hope West average (95.6 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 9 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 3 cases , up 50.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Anti-social behaviour ( 100.0% YoY). Other major crime categories were broadly unchanged compared to 2025.

Violent crimes totalled 9 (≈ 19.7 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 28.6%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-87.9%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around London Road (SS17 0LB), the main crime hotspot is near Baryta Close. Police recorded 57 crimes here, including 16 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
